马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有账号?立即注册
×
本帖最后由 st788796 于 2014-2-14 10:54 编辑
 - ;;control ---- string
- ;;lst ---- '(curselindex (string1 string2 ...))
- ;;var ---- cursel
- (defun DCL_OptionList_Pross (name lst var / control)
- (if (setq control (eval (read name)))
- (progn
- (dcl-control-setbuttoncaptionlist control (cadr lst))
- (dcl-optionlist-setcursel control (car lst))
- (eval (list 'defun
- (read (strcat "c:" name "/#OnSelChanged"))
- '(ItemIndexOrCount Value /)
- (list 'setq var 'Value)
- '(princ)
- )
- );_设定 SelChanged 事件回调函数
- (dcl-control-setproperty
- control
- "SelChanged"
- (strcat "c:" name "/#OnSelChanged")
- );_设定回调事件
- )
- )
- )
var 为全局变量,返回选中的按钮的 caption
可以用在 Form Initialize 中
|